A DVD recording of a service celebrating the life of Labour Party stalwart Ray Davies is to be sold to raise money for his beloved Bedwas Workmen’s Hall.

Mr Davies, who battled pancreatic cancer, died on May 7 at the age of 85.

A prominent member of the Campaign for Nuclear Disarmament and the Palestine Solidarity Campaign, Mr Davies was arrested on anti-nuclear protests and was even shot in the head in Palestine while escorting ambulances carrying injured Palestinians in Balata in 2003.

Hundreds attended a remembrance service at the Temple of Peace, Cardiff in July to celebrate the life of the veteran Bedwas, Trethomas and Machen councillor, who has been described by many as a “one-off”.

Among those in attendance were Caerphilly MP Wayne David, Newport West MP Paul Flynn, South Wales East AM Lindsay Whittle and Welsh author Angharad Tomos.

On the request of the family, a professional filmmaker, Marcos Avlontitis, captured the event with three cameras.

This recording is the basis for a DVD, which will also feature a live recordings of songs from the many campaigns Mr Davies was involved in, including Miners Lifeguard, Solidarity Forever, Nkosi Sikelele, Guantanamera and Yma o Hyd.

These were performed by the Côr Cochion choir, who are conducted by Mr Davies’ widow, Wendy Lewis.

Proceeds from the sale of the DVDs will go to Red Ray's Lift appeal, which hopes to make his beloved Bedwas Workmen's Hall fully accessible to the community.

Mr Davies’ widow, Ms Lewis, 59, was moved to do this after members of the family found it difficult to attend Mr Davies’ funeral at the hall.

With no lift in the hall, which was built in 1923, elderly family members struggled to climb the two steep flights of stairs and some even had to be carried up the fire escape.

Speaking about the DVD, whose cover was designed by Mr Davies’ son, Tad, Ms Lewis said: “It looks very good. The sound quality is excellent. It’s an interesting DVD.

“He would’ve wanted us not to grieve…but to carry on his work.

“He covered a huge breadth. Plaid Cymru, the Communist Party, Labour, the Greens, the Socialist Workers Party – not many people get them all in the same room.

“He cut across all borders for the common goal. All the things he did have been a great comfort for me.

“He gave 100% to every campaign and was spread very thin to do all he did.

“I hope this will kick start the fund.”
